王鐵軍 周易 高楊
摘要:針對(duì)航空發(fā)動(dòng)機(jī)刷式密封試驗(yàn)器,基于西門子“PLC-WinCC”軟硬件平臺(tái),設(shè)計(jì)了一套自動(dòng)控制系統(tǒng)。該系統(tǒng)能夠?qū)崿F(xiàn)試驗(yàn)器空氣系統(tǒng)、液壓加載系統(tǒng)、滑油系統(tǒng)的手動(dòng)和自動(dòng)控制,自動(dòng)控制方式能夠?qū)崿F(xiàn)基于載荷譜的試驗(yàn)流程自動(dòng)化運(yùn)行。另外,具有試驗(yàn)參數(shù)超限報(bào)警、硬件故障報(bào)警、報(bào)警報(bào)表、試驗(yàn)計(jì)時(shí)等功能。配合LabVIEW平臺(tái)的測試系統(tǒng)軟件,能夠?qū)崿F(xiàn)試驗(yàn)器的控制、測試數(shù)據(jù)記錄以及顯示等功能。目前,該試驗(yàn)器已投入使用,運(yùn)行穩(wěn)定可靠。
關(guān)鍵詞:刷式密封試驗(yàn)器;PLC;WinCC;自動(dòng)控制
0 ?引言
航空發(fā)動(dòng)機(jī)刷式密封的耐久性試驗(yàn)耗時(shí)長,且不需頻繁操作,常規(guī)的試驗(yàn)器手動(dòng)控制模式精度低,且很容易造成試驗(yàn)人員過度疲勞,對(duì)試驗(yàn)精確性和安全性造成影響。因此需要一種試驗(yàn)器的自動(dòng)控制系統(tǒng),提高控制精度,減輕試驗(yàn)人員的操作負(fù)擔(dān)。
本文采用西門子“PLC-WinCC”軟硬件平臺(tái),搭建了一套用于刷式密封試驗(yàn)器的自動(dòng)控制系統(tǒng)。主要包括PLC控制系統(tǒng)、WinCC人機(jī)交互系統(tǒng)二部分。
1 ?PLC控制系統(tǒng)
PLC控制系統(tǒng)硬件采用S7-300PLC作為控制核心,軟件采用了結(jié)構(gòu)化編程方法,設(shè)計(jì)了如表1所示的若干程序塊。
表1中:“OB塊”為系統(tǒng)組織塊,“OB1 主程序”負(fù)責(zé)調(diào)用各個(gè)功能塊實(shí)現(xiàn)相應(yīng)的控制功能,“OB35 PID模塊讀寫”負(fù)責(zé)與FM355閉環(huán)控制模塊進(jìn)行信息交互,“OB32 計(jì)時(shí)”負(fù)責(zé)系統(tǒng)所有的計(jì)時(shí)功能[1]?!癋C功能塊”為PLC控制系統(tǒng)具備的各項(xiàng)功能。“FC標(biāo)準(zhǔn)功能模塊”是針對(duì)一些常用的功能,基于通用化思想設(shè)計(jì)的標(biāo)準(zhǔn)模塊,塊內(nèi)所有變量都是局部變量,在使用時(shí)由調(diào)用它的功能塊通過變量接口為局部變量賦值[2]?!癉B數(shù)據(jù)塊”存儲(chǔ)自動(dòng)試驗(yàn)載荷譜、各功能塊的背景數(shù)據(jù)、通過通訊得到的測試系統(tǒng)采集參數(shù)、PLC模擬量的參數(shù)限值等。
“OB35 PID模塊讀寫”通過FM355模塊,能夠?qū)崿F(xiàn)試驗(yàn)進(jìn)氣壓力、試驗(yàn)進(jìn)氣溫度、前卸荷腔氣體壓力的閉環(huán)控制。
“FC5 自動(dòng)試驗(yàn)”為控制系統(tǒng)的核心功能,能夠?qū)崿F(xiàn)基于載荷譜的自動(dòng)試驗(yàn)控制。 “DB1自動(dòng)試驗(yàn)載荷譜”數(shù)塊能夠存儲(chǔ)10步載荷譜,循環(huán)次數(shù)不限。利用指針,將變量“當(dāng)前步數(shù)”轉(zhuǎn)換為對(duì)應(yīng)步載荷譜的地址偏移量,讀取變量并賦值給“當(dāng)前主電機(jī)轉(zhuǎn)速”等變量,最后將“當(dāng)前”變量賦值輸出給對(duì)應(yīng)控制信號(hào),完成自動(dòng)控制。
2 ?WinCC人機(jī)交互系統(tǒng)
基于WinCC平臺(tái)設(shè)計(jì)了刷式密封試驗(yàn)器自動(dòng)控制系統(tǒng)的人機(jī)交互系統(tǒng),主要包括“試驗(yàn)設(shè)置”、“自動(dòng)試驗(yàn)”、“空氣系統(tǒng)”、“液壓&滑油”、“報(bào)警顯示”、“報(bào)警報(bào)表”幾個(gè)部分。
“試驗(yàn)設(shè)置”頁面能夠?qū)⑤d荷譜存入PLC,設(shè)置載荷譜步數(shù)與循環(huán)次數(shù)等數(shù)據(jù),與測試系統(tǒng)進(jìn)行數(shù)據(jù)傳輸。
“空氣系統(tǒng)”和“液壓&滑油”界面能夠圖形化顯示試驗(yàn)器的結(jié)構(gòu)、全部傳感器及其數(shù)據(jù),實(shí)現(xiàn)試驗(yàn)器的手動(dòng)控制。
“報(bào)警顯示”界面以指示燈的形式顯示系統(tǒng)所有的報(bào)警信號(hào),“報(bào)警報(bào)表”界面以報(bào)表的形式記錄報(bào)警信號(hào)產(chǎn)生與消失的時(shí)間,并能夠?qū)?bào)表另存為報(bào)表文件。
“自動(dòng)試驗(yàn)”界面如圖1所示。該界面內(nèi)上方為自動(dòng)試驗(yàn)的各個(gè)操作按鈕。開始試驗(yàn)前,確定載荷譜無誤后,點(diǎn)擊“初始化”按鈕對(duì)PLC進(jìn)行初始化設(shè)置。然后點(diǎn)擊“試驗(yàn)開始”按鈕開始自動(dòng)試驗(yàn),此時(shí)“試驗(yàn)運(yùn)行”指示燈點(diǎn)亮為綠色,測試系統(tǒng)開始記錄試驗(yàn)數(shù)據(jù)。
載荷譜第一步設(shè)置為試驗(yàn)器狀態(tài)的目標(biāo)值,并顯示在“設(shè)定值”一欄中,“當(dāng)前值”一欄則顯示試驗(yàn)器當(dāng)前各項(xiàng)參數(shù)值。試驗(yàn)人員觀察對(duì)比“設(shè)定值”和“當(dāng)前值”,當(dāng)試驗(yàn)器狀態(tài)達(dá)到載荷譜要求時(shí),點(diǎn)擊“單步計(jì)時(shí)開始”按鈕,該按鈕點(diǎn)亮,同時(shí)激活當(dāng)前步的計(jì)時(shí)。單步計(jì)時(shí)達(dá)到載荷譜當(dāng)前步規(guī)定時(shí)間后,“單步計(jì)時(shí)開始”按鈕熄滅,該步試驗(yàn)完成,下一步載荷譜自動(dòng)設(shè)定為目標(biāo)值,試驗(yàn)器參數(shù)進(jìn)入過渡態(tài)。如此循環(huán)重復(fù),直至自動(dòng)試驗(yàn)載荷譜要求的試驗(yàn)步數(shù)和循環(huán)次數(shù)全部完成。試驗(yàn)過程中可點(diǎn)擊“試驗(yàn)停車”按鈕停止自動(dòng)試驗(yàn)進(jìn)程,此時(shí)測試系統(tǒng)數(shù)據(jù)記錄暫停,試驗(yàn)器狀態(tài)仍然為載荷譜給定狀態(tài),點(diǎn)擊“試驗(yàn)開始”按鈕可以繼續(xù)。
當(dāng)載荷譜兩步之間過渡時(shí)間過長時(shí),試驗(yàn)人員可以切換為遠(yuǎn)程手動(dòng)操作模式加快試驗(yàn)器的狀態(tài)過渡。首先根據(jù)需求進(jìn)入“空氣系統(tǒng)”或“液壓&滑油”界面,點(diǎn)擊“試驗(yàn)?zāi)J健敝械摹笆謩?dòng)”按鈕,切換為手動(dòng)模式,開始對(duì)試驗(yàn)器的參數(shù)進(jìn)行調(diào)整,同時(shí)測試系統(tǒng)的數(shù)據(jù)記錄暫停。調(diào)整完畢后,點(diǎn)擊“試驗(yàn)?zāi)J健敝械摹白詣?dòng)”按鈕并返回“自動(dòng)試驗(yàn)”界面,試驗(yàn)器將繼續(xù)按照載荷譜進(jìn)行試驗(yàn),同時(shí)測試系統(tǒng)數(shù)據(jù)記錄繼續(xù)。
當(dāng)載荷譜運(yùn)行完成后,“試驗(yàn)運(yùn)行”指示燈熄滅,“試驗(yàn)完成”指示燈點(diǎn)亮為綠色,測試系統(tǒng)數(shù)據(jù)記錄停止,試驗(yàn)器仍維持在最后一步的設(shè)定值。此時(shí)切換為手動(dòng)模式,根據(jù)需求對(duì)試驗(yàn)器進(jìn)行停轉(zhuǎn)、停氣或降溫等操作,點(diǎn)擊“初始化”按鈕將PLC內(nèi)自動(dòng)試驗(yàn)各相關(guān)量進(jìn)行初始化操作。此時(shí),自動(dòng)試驗(yàn)全部完成。
3 ?結(jié)論
本文針對(duì)刷式密封試驗(yàn)器,設(shè)計(jì)了一套自動(dòng)控制系統(tǒng),能夠?qū)崿F(xiàn)試驗(yàn)器的手動(dòng)控制和基于載荷譜的自動(dòng)試驗(yàn)控制。該系統(tǒng)工作穩(wěn)定,自動(dòng)化程度高,易于維護(hù)和后期功能擴(kuò)展。對(duì)類似試驗(yàn)器控制系統(tǒng)的設(shè)計(jì)工作有一定參考和借鑒價(jià)值。
參考文獻(xiàn):
[1]廖常初. S7-300 /400 PLC 應(yīng)用技術(shù)[M].機(jī)械工業(yè)出版社,2005.
[2]張春.西門子STEP7編程語言與使用技巧[M].機(jī)械工業(yè)出版社,2009.
[3]鞏文東.一類新型配料機(jī)電氣自動(dòng)控制系統(tǒng)設(shè)計(jì)[J].內(nèi)燃機(jī)與配件,2019(20):208-209.